CYFIRMA reported that healthcare organizations are facing an increasingly hostile cyber threat environment, with ransomware emerging as the sector’s most significant risk. Over the past 90 days, healthcare accounted for 216 verified ransomware victims, representing 9.05% of ransomware victims globally and ranking the sector third among 14 industries.
